PokeFinder Extension

Ever read an article or post about Pokemon TCG and wonder exactly what that card did and have to then pop open another tab and search for that card? Not anymore!

With this extension you can click the PokeBall on any page that mentions Pokemon TCG cards and it'll scan through the text and add a PokeBall next to any Pokemon it finds. Hovering over that PokeBall will show you a quick preview of that card right in the article! Couldn't be simpler.

I built this for myself because I was new to the game and was annoyed having to keep searching for cards to figure out exactly what they did as I was reading about decks and strategy - so I built this so I wouldn't have to do that anymore.

Hope this helps others as well!

How to download and manually install PokeFinder extension for Chrome

Looking for a way to install PokeFinder extensions for Chrome, you can search for them in the Chrome Web Store, clicking the "Add to Chrome" button, and following the straightforward process.

However, you may need to install PokeFinder extensions manually, this article outlines two simple methods to effortlessly install PokeFinder extensions, whether they come as unpacked folders in compressed formats like .zip or as .crx files.

Method 1: Download PokeFinder extension and manually install through Drag &Drop

If you ever need to manually install a PokeFinder extension for Chrome, don't worry, it's a simple process. Just follow these easy steps, and you will have your extension ready to use in no time.

Step 1: Download the PokeFinder Extension by clicking the "Download CRX" button on the website.

Look for the PokeFinder extension you wish to install. Go to the website and download the PokeFinder extension package, which is usually a .CRX file and comes in a zipped file. Here ".crx" file is the format for PokeFinder extension that contains all the data.

Step 2: Extract &Arrange Files

Once the file is downloaded, extract that file into its own folder. Similarly, give that extension files a permanent home. In other words, keep it in a folder that you don't accidentally delete it because these files will be needed to make that extension work.

Step 3: Go to the Chrome Extensions Page

Open Google Chrome and in the address bar, type chrome://extensions; it will open the Google Chrome extensions page. Make sure that "My extensions" is selected in the sidebar.

Step 4: Drag and Drop the Extension

Now, go to the folder where you extracted the PokeFinder extension and drag &drop the extension file from there anywhere onto the extension page within Google Chrome.

Step 5: Complete the Installation

Once you drag and drop the extension file, follow the steps that Google Chrome takes you through. Similarly, if the extension file is of .crx file format, you will be required to review the permissions and then add the extension.

Now, you can manage that added extension as you would like to with any other Chrome extension that you added through Chrome Webstore. Its icon will also appear in the Google Chrome Menu on the right side of the address bar once you activate it.

Method 2: Download PokeFinder extension for Chrome and install in Developer Mode

This is another method to install PokeFinder extension manually, but the twist is that here, you install by enabling the developer mode option provided in Google Chrome. This mode is commonly used for testing extensions or running unpublished tools.

Step 1: Download the PokeFinder extension file

Select and download the PokeFinder extension by clicking the 'Download CRX' button on the website.

Step 2: Extract the downloaded contents

Convert the file to a ZIP file if it is in CRX format then extract the PokeFinder extension zip file or folder that you downloaded. Make sure you extract it using the same folder name and keep it safely in another folder, so you don't delete it by mistake. The extracted folder will be needed to keep your PokeFinder extension running.

Step 3: Open Chrome Extension Setting Page

In the address bar of Google Chrome, type chrome://extensions and open the Chrome Extension Page.

Step 4: Enable Developer Mode

After opening the Chrome Extension page, look at the top right side, and you will find the toggle option of "Developer mode."Simply enable that developer mode option.

Step 5: Load the Unpacked Extension

Once you enable the developer mode option, you will see the menu of Load Unpacked, Pack Extensions and Update. From that, select the option "Load unpacked."

Step 6: Select the Extension Folder

Once the pop-up opens upon clicking Load unpacked, select the PokeFinder extension directory and click on the "Select Folder "button.

Step 7: Confirm and Install

After you select an extension folder of a Google Chrome extension you're installing manually, confirm its installation for the final time and let the installation complete.
